Structuring Your Message

A well-structured message is easy to read and understand. Here’s a simple guide to help you organize your thoughts:

  • Greeting: Start with a warm greeting. You can address the organizers, the community, or a specific individual involved in the event.
  • Congratulatory Statement: Express your congratulations on the successful opening ceremony. Mention the specific event and its significance.
  • Support and Well-Wishes: Offer your support and well-wishes for the future. You can mention how you believe the event will benefit the community.
  • Closing: End with a warm closing statement. You can include your name and any additional information if necessary.

Sample Congratulatory Messages

Here are a few sample messages to inspire you:

Sample 1:

"Dear [Organizers/Community],

Warmest congratulations on the successful opening of the Morley Community Center. We are thrilled to see this new space come to life and believe it will be a wonderful addition to our community. Wishing you all the best as you embark on this exciting journey.

Sincerely,

[Your Name]"

Sample 2:

"To the Morley Opening Ceremony Committee,

On behalf of [Your Organization], we extend our heartfelt congratulations on the grand opening of the new Morley Public Library. This is a momentous occasion that will undoubtedly enrich our community. We look forward to seeing all the wonderful opportunities this new library will bring.

Best regards,

[Your Name]"

Tips for Writing an Effective Message

Here are some additional tips to help you write an effective congratulatory message:

  • Be Specific: Mention the specific event and its significance to make your message more personal and meaningful.
  • Keep It Concise: While it's important to convey your well-wishes, keep your message concise and to the point.
  • Proofread: Ensure your message is free of errors. A well-written message reflects your attention to detail and respect for the occasion.
  • Personalize: If possible, personalize your message by mentioning specific individuals or groups involved in the event.
